1. A image decoding method performed by a decoding apparatus comprising:
receiving a bitstream including information on a merge index;
constructing a merging candidate list for a current block, wherein the merging candidate list includes spatial merging candidates;
deriving motion information of the current block based on one of the spatial merging candidates indicated by the merge index in the merging candidate list;
deriving a predicted block of the current block based on the derived motion information; and
generating a reconstructed picture based on the predicted block,
wherein the current block is related to a partition, and the partition is one of partitions partitioned from a coding unit (CU),
wherein the partitions within the CU belong to a merging candidate sharing unit,
wherein the spatial merging candidates for the partition are identical to spatial merging candidates of the CU which has a same size as the merging candidate sharing unit,
wherein the spatial merging candidates for the partition within the CU which has the same size as the merging candidate sharing unit, are derived from a lower left corner neighboring block, a left neighboring block, an upper right corner neighboring block, an upper neighboring block and an upper left corner neighboring block of the merging candidate sharing unit.
